An experiment was conducted to determine whether either ring temperature or furnace position affects the baked density of a carbon anode. The data are as follows: Temperature (\"C) Position 800 825 850 1 570 1063 565 565 1080 510 583 1043 590 2 528 988 526 547 1026 538 521 1004 532 a. State the hypotheses of interest. b. Test the hypotheses in part (a) using the analysis of variance with o = 0.05. What are your conclusions? c. Analyze the residuals from this experiment. [Calculate the residual values and run a normality test on it) d. Using t-test comparison, investigate the differences between the mean baked anode density at the three different levels of temperature. Use (1 = 0.05
